Size

When choosing a new mattress, it is important to think about the dimensions of the mattress. A bed that is too small for you or your spouse could negatively affect the quality of your sleep. Be sure to consider your size and height when deciding on a bed single mattress.

Standard twin-sized mattresses measure 38 inches wide and 75 inches long. This is the smallest of all adult-size mattresses, and is great for children who have outgrown their cribs or for an adults living in smaller spaces.

If you want a larger mattress, consider a full-size or queen-size mattress. These beds measure 54 inches wide which is 21 inches more wide than the standard twin size. They are ideal for couples, however they can also be used by single sleepers if the room is large enough to accommodate a queen-sized mattress.

Full-size mattresses offer 27 inches of space, so they may not be the best choice if are sharing a bed one who moves around during the night. Memory foam mattresses are worth looking at if you are looking for a mattress that minimizes motion transfer.

You should also think about your sleeping position when you decide on the size of the mattress. A larger mattress will give you more legroom for those who sleep on your back or on your side. If you prefer sleeping on your side and back, a smaller mattress will be more comfortable.

Materials

The materials used to make a mattress are essential as they determine the comfort and support. The most popular materials are foam, latex and innersprings.

Foam is one of the most commonly used types of material in mattresses and comes in many kinds, including memory gel memory foam and polyurethane. These forms of foam are recognized for their softness and rebounded (or viscoelastic) properties, and ability to mold to your body.

A typical mattress is comprised of an innerspring core that is supported by a variety of upholstery layers. The innerspring core is generally composed of coils, or springs that are shaped according to your body. The coils are placed in an "innerspring core", which is often broken down into smaller parts by wire. The inside of the unit is covered with two or more thin layers of fabric that protect the coils from scratching and prevent them from colliding with one another.

An innerspring mattress may have many kinds of springs, but the most common are Bonnell and offset coils which are flattened and hinged together using helical wires in order to create an hourglass-shaped coil. The innerspring may be encased in a sheet of fabric, which helps to preserve its shape.

Innerspring coils expand when pressure is applied to them and then spring back once the pressure is released. Using coils with different gauges, they can offer a range of firmness, from softer to extremely firm.

Coils are measured in quarter increments, with lower-gauge coils offering more comfort under pressure and larger-gauge coils offering a more firm feel. The number of coils within an innerspring unit as well as the degree of tightness with the rest of them determine the feeling of the mattress.

Additionally the coils can be flipped and rotated to decrease wear over time. This rotation is possible every month for the first six months, and every two to three months after that.

Some people prefer to purchase organic mattresses made of natural materials such as wool or cotton that are safe for your health and the environment. These are usually more expensive than other types of mattresses, but when you're committed to living green living it's worth the extra cost.

Comfort

When you're looking for a mattress that is comfortable, it's important to consider the comfort. is one of the first things you should consider. The kind of foam, the comfort system and the mattress's structure can all affect how comfy it is for you.

Comfort is a subjective term It's therefore important to take into account how different people feel about a mattress's slumber level. The most common comfort factors often used are bounce, edge support and contouring as well as temperature control and motion isolation.

Bounce: A mattress that bounces back and forth faster is more flexible, which makes it easier to move around on. This is especially true of close-conforming substances like memory foam and polyfoam.

Contoured Mattresses that conform to the body's contours is more comfortable than a non-conforming material. This helps to reduce pressure points and helps maintain the correct alignment of your spine throughout the night.

Temperature regulation: A mattress that is ventilated and allows airflow can regulate your body's temperature. This makes it more comfortable to sleep on. This is often achieved by using natural materials such as latex in the comfort layers instead of foam.

Firmness: Back and stomach sleepers will prefer a mattress that is more firm. It assists in relieving pressure on shoulders, hips and spine by keeping your body in a neutral position.

Softness: People who weigh less than 200 lbs typically prefer a soft mattress. Although it can relieve pain and discomfort for larger people however, it's not as comfortable as a firm or medium-firm mattress.

A softer mattress might also feel too soft, which could make it difficult to sleep or to get relief from back pain. For this reason, it's not recommended to use a mattress with a soft feel for side sleepers or those who weigh more than 210lbs.

Spring mattresses are an alternative for people who want to sleep on a plush mattress but don't want to sink in the mattress. They typically have pocketed coils in individual compartments that respond to your body's movements in a way that is independent.

If you're not sure which kind of mattress will work for you, think about a hybrid that combines of foam and springs to give you a comfortable level. This type of mattress is usually more affordable than other kinds and is a great way to give you an idea of how each one feels before you commit to buying a queen-size or full-size mattress.

Durability

Many factors influence the durability of a mattress, including its original quality, materials used, and the way it is maintained. However, the majority of experts recommend replacing mattresses about every seven years.

The kind of mattress you buy also impacts its lifespan, with all-foam mattresses having the longest expected life. In addition the way you use your mattress (as as your body weight and sleeping position) can also influence the longevity of your mattress.

For instance, those who sleep more might notice their beds start to lose their shape, and side sleepers might experience a lot of sagging around the hips and shoulders.

The durability of a mattress is affected by the material it is made of as well, with substances like memory foam or latex being able to last longer than other materials. This is particularly relevant for organic latex mattresses made from 100 100% natural latex. These mattresses are well-known for their longevity over those that are chemically treated.

If you're considering one mattress, be certain to know its return and warranty policies. This will ensure you have the most enjoyable experience from your new purchase.

You'll enjoy a peaceful and comfortable sleep if you select the right mattress. This will increase your overall well-being and productivity.

One thing you can do to extend the life of your mattress is to rotate it frequently. This spreads wear over the entire mattress, and also prevent body impressions from developing.

A mattress that is not vulnerable to sagging is an additional suggestion. You can select an all-foam or hybrid mattress single mattress to achieve this.

The best mattresses are made of durable materials. They are available at all prices and are constructed from many different materials. The best option for you is to choose a mattress that suits your specific needs and budget.

All the materials used in your mattress must be tested to ensure that they are free of chemicals, including VOCs. You can get certifications from CertiPUR, OEKO-TEX, and other organizations that test the safety of materials used in mattresses. These will ensure that your new single mattress mattress is free of any harmful substances.
